Responsibilities and tasks

  • Develop and deliver engaging theater workshops to train community members in acting, scriptwriting, directing, and stage management.
  • Create and direct performances that address local social issues, promote community dialogue, and encourage positive behavioral change.
  •  Identify and mentor individuals with a passion for drama, helping them enhance their skills and build confidence in their abilities.
  • Collaborate with community members to create scripts and performances that reflect their stories, traditions, and challenges.
  • Assess the effectiveness of theater activities in achieving community goals and provide constructive feedback to participants for continuous improvement.
